Definition of "ghetto" in Englisch

noun

  1. An (often walled) area of a city in which Jews are concentrated by force and law. (Used particularly of areas in medieval Italy and in Nazi-controlled Europe.)

  2. An (often impoverished) area of a city inhabited predominantly by members of a specific nationality, ethnicity, or race.

  3. An area in which people who are distinguished by sharing something other than ethnicity concentrate or are concentrated.

  4. (figurative, sometimes derogatory) An isolated, self-contained, segregated subsection, area or field of interest; often of minority or specialist interest.

    • 2016 January 10, Quentin Tarantino, 73rd Golden Globe Awards Ennio Morricone... is my favourite composer - and when I say favourite composer, I don't mean movie composer - that ghetto. I'm talking about Mozart, I'm talking about Beethoven, I'm talking about Schubert. That's who I'm talking about.

adjective

  1. Of or relating to a ghetto or to ghettos in general.

  2. (slang, informal) Unseemly and indecorous or of low quality; cheap; shabby, crude.

    • My apartment's so ghetto, the rats and cockroaches filed a complaint with the city!
    • I like to drive ghetto cars; if they break down you can just abandon them and pick up a new one!
  3. (US, informal, often derogatory or offensive) Characteristic of the style, speech, or behavior of residents of a predominantly black or other ghetto in the United States.

  4. Having been raised in a ghetto in the United States.

verb

  1. (transitive) To confine (a specified group of people) to a ghetto.
